sqlite 数据库


 数据库 (database) : 存放数据的仓库 . 存放的是一张一张的表 , 特别像: Excel , Numbers 都以表格形式存放数据 . 可以创建多张表 ,
    常见的数据库: sqlite   , MySQL ,SQLServer ,Oracle , access
     为什么要用到数据库 .
     1. 文件读写 , 归档 读取数据时需要一次把数据全部读出来. 占内存 ,
    2. 数据库效率很高 . 体现在增 ,删 , 改 , 查
    
    SQL(Structured Query Language) 结构化查询语句 , 用于对数据库的操作语句 (增 ,删 , 改 , 查)
    
     SQL语句不区分大小写 , 字符串需要加双引号.或者单引号
      * : 代表所有
     Where : 条件 , 可以不写 .
    
     创建表 : create table 表名 (字段名 字段数据类型 是否主键, 字段名 字段类型 , ....) ;
     主键是一条数据的唯一标识符 . 一张表里只能有一个主键 , 并且主键不能够重复 . 一般把主键名设置为 "id" , 不需要赋值 ,会自动添加 .
    
     查 : Select 字段名 (或者 *) From 表名 Where 字段 = 值
    
     增 : insert into 表名 (字段1 , 字段2, ....) values (值1 , 值2 ,....)
    
     改 : update 表名 set 字段名 = 值  Where 字段 = 值
    
     删 : delete from 表名 where 字段  = 值

sqlite 数据库

上一篇:sqlite3 数据操作 查询单个信息


下一篇:【异常】Cannot construct instance of `com.facebook.presto.jdbc.internal.client.QueryResults`, problem: stats is null